Understanding the Components:
- Akimbo: This word describes a posture where a person stands with their hands on their hips and their elbows bent outwards. It's often associated with a stance of readiness, defiance, or casual confidence. For example, someone might stand "akimbo" while waiting or observing.
- Akita: This refers to a breed of large, powerful dog originating from Japan. Akitas are known for their distinctive appearance, courage, and loyalty to their families. They are not associated with any specific actions or techniques beyond typical dog behaviors and training.
